Output bf6af7ae0417d2227ec3f41e24505735679cccb0f4a63bfcca074e91f12c0b4e:0

value
151533
script pubkey
OP_0 OP_PUSHBYTES_20 e95e39a5623a50a6382b4613b171a169ee1b5ea8
address
bc1qa90rnftz8fg2vwptgcfmzudpd8hpkh4gwc66mh
transaction
bf6af7ae0417d2227ec3f41e24505735679cccb0f4a63bfcca074e91f12c0b4e
spent
true